The SSCA has a zero-tolerance approach to any form of intimidation, threatening behaviour, harassment or verbal abuse directed towards Staff, Officials, Volunteers or any person carrying out their duties at an event.
Every Official is entitled to carry out their role in a safe environment without fear of abuse, confrontation or intimidation.
Disagreements with decisions must be dealt with through the appropriate channels and in a respectful manner.
Aggressive behaviour, abusive language, personal insults, threatening conduct, or attempts to intimidate Officials either at the venue, by phone, through social media, or via private messages will not be tolerated under any circumstances.
Any individual found to have engaged in such behaviour should expect the matter to be referred directly to the SSCA Disciplinary Panel, where a significant suspension from racing will imposed.
Respect for Officials is fundamental to the safe and fair running of our sport, and everyone competing at an event is expected to uphold these standards at all times.
